Spécifications

Attribut Valeur
Package / Case Tape & Reel (TR),Cut Tape (CT)
Part Status Active
Reference Type Series
Output Type Fixed
Voltage - Output (Min/Fixed) 2.5V
Current - Output 10 mA
Tolerance ±0.1%
Temperature Coefficient 8ppm/°C
Noise - 01 Hzto10 Hz 3µVp-p
Voltage - Input 2.7V ~ 18V
Supply Current 1.2mA
Operating Temperature -40°C ~ 125°C (TA)
Mounting Type Surface Mount

Features

The REF5025AIDR is a precision voltage reference typically used for applications requiring a stable and accurate voltage source. Key features include:
1. Output Voltage: The device provides a precise 2.5V output.
2. High Accuracy: It offers excellent initial accuracy with a low temperature coefficient, ensuring stability across varying temperatures.
3. Low Noise: The REF5025AIDR is designed to minimize output voltage noise, making it suitable for high-precision applications.
4. Low Drift: It maintains a consistent voltage output over time and temperature changes, offering low long-term drift.
5. Wide Supply Range: The device operates over a broad supply voltage range, typically from 5V to 18V, providing flexibility in different circuit designs.
6. Low Power Consumption: It is designed for efficiency, consuming minimal power, which is advantageous for battery-operated devices.
7. Small Package: Available in a space-saving SOIC-8 package, facilitating easy integration into various designs.
8. Thermal Stability: Good thermal stability makes it reliable under varying operational conditions.
These features make the REF5025AIDR suitable for high-performance data acquisition systems, test equipment, and other applications requiring precise voltage references.

Application

The REF5025AIDR is a voltage reference IC known for high precision and low drift, commonly used in various applications requiring stable voltage references. Key application areas include:
1. Data Acquisition Systems: Ensures accurate analog-to-digital conversion by providing a stable reference.
2. Medical Devices: Offers precise voltage references for sensitive imaging and diagnostic equipment.
3. Industrial Automation: Used in control systems for consistent performance.
4. Instrumentation: Provides accuracy and stability for measurement instruments.
5. Telecommunications: Supports stable voltage references in signal processing equipment.
6. Consumer Electronics: Enhances performance in devices requiring precise voltage regulation.
These applications benefit from the IC's stability, low noise, and temperature performance.
